安裝vs2017後,RDLC 報表定義具備沒法升級的無效目標命名空間

原先的RDLC報表定義用的命名空間是2008,用vs2017報表設計器從新保存後,會自動升級成2016,致使沒法使用。sql

不想升級控件,太麻煩,因此就手動修改RDLC文件吧。sqlserver

一、修改http://schemas.microsoft.com/sqlserver/reporting/2016/01/reportdefinition,將2016改爲2008設計

二、將BODY的父節點<ReportSections><ReportSection>...</ReportSection></ReportSections>刪除server

三、刪除<ReportParametersLayout>整個節點it

其它的看具體出錯信息再處理吧。io

相關文章
相關標籤/搜索